Leidos' Defense Systems is seeking a Quality Control Manager to join our team.
Primary Responsibilities
Leadership & Team Development
Lead the IMCOM HHA program quality team, ensuring compliance with Army quality and regulatory standards.
Provide hands-on leadership to the IMCOM HHA team, mentoring and developing inspectors to ensure efficient operational support and continuous improvement.
Coach, train, and guide program quality staff to align with the corporate Quality Management System and Defense Systems Sector requirements.
Foster a program quality strategy and culture committed to excellence and Leidos values, enabling rapid manufacturing scaling.
Quality Program Management & Compliance
Maintain close coordination with the Leidos site quality team to ensure consistent process control, product acceptance, and effective execution of corrective actions.
Oversee inspection documentation, ensuring compliance with customer requirements and configuration baselines.
Support readiness reviews, Continuous improvement plans, configuration audits, and fulfillment of contractual deliverables related to quality data and acceptance.
Customer & Supplier Interface
Serve as the primary interface with external quality stakeholders.
Maintain oversight of quality performance, ensuring metrics, audits, and corrective actions align with program and Army standards.
Metrics, Analysis & Improvement
Establish, monitor, and analyze quality metrics and targeted KPIs to drive performance visibility, process health, improvement, and compliance.
Analyze KPI trends and inspection data to proactively identify systemic issues, drive root cause investigations, and implement corrective and preventive actions.
Drive continual improvement initiatives to enhance conformity, reduce rework, and strengthen mission assurance.
Process & Issue Management
Develop, implement, and oversee inspection strategies, including statistically valid sampling plans aligned with customer, regulatory, and corporate standards.
Drive Review Boards (MRB) and ensure timely closure of root cause and corrective actions across all program areas. Identify root causes and trends for issues.
Ensure timely and sustained resolution of internal and external audit findings and requirement escapes by conducting root cause analysis and implementing corrective and preventive measures.
Effectively address escalated quality issues in a timely manner.
Business Lifecycle & Reporting
Serve as a stakeholder for quality throughout the business lifecycle, including new business capture, procurement, program execution.
Partner with engineering, manufacturing, and supply chain teams to achieve Force Protection improvement reliability objectives.
Report regularly to senior leadership on inspection results, KPI performance, audit outcomes, and quality improvement progress.

Securing Your Data
Beware of fake employment opportunities using Leidos' name. Leidos will never ask you to provide payment-related information during any part of the employment application process (i.e., ask you for money), nor will Leidos ever advance money as part of the hiring process (i.e., send you a check or money order before doing any work). Further, Leidos will only communicate with you through emails that are generated by the Leidos.com automated system - never from free commercial services (e.g., Gmail, Yahoo, Hotmail) or via WhatsApp, Telegram, etc. If you received an email purporting to be from Leidos that asks for payment-related information or any other personal information (e.g., about you or your previous employer), and you are concerned about its legitimacy, please make us aware immediately by emailing us at View email address on click.appcast.io .
If you believe you are the victim of a scam, contact your local law enforcement and report the incident to the U.S. Federal Trade Commission ( .
